Ebola in eastern DRC has passed 5,000 cases. The vaccine has arrived
The DRC has received 70,000 Ervebo doses as Ebola cases exceed 5,000 and deaths reach 2,378, while movement controls and attacks on ambulances constrain the response.

On 20 August 2026, the Democratic Republic of the Congo received 70,000 doses of Ervebo for its Ebola outbreak response. The delivery came as the country faced more than 5,000 reported cases, 2,378 deaths and a disease described by responders as spreading faster than efforts to contain it in the remote east.
The vaccine gives health teams another tool, but it does not resolve the central difficulty: reaching affected communities while movement is restricted, ambulances are attacked and fear is keeping some pregnant women away from healthcare. The scale is now explicit
Africanews reported on 19 August that the DRC had recorded more than 5,000 Ebola cases and 2,378 deaths. Its report said responders were warning that the haemorrhagic virus was spreading at an unprecedented rate and outpacing efforts to slow it in remote eastern areas of the country.

The dose that arrived
The consignment of 70,000 Ervebo doses is a concrete addition to the response. Africanews reported on 20 August that the DRC had received the doses, rather than merely dispatching them. The same report said WHO experts cited early evidence, including animal studies, suggesting that Ervebo could offer some protection and that a new trial would seek to establish whether that protection extends to humans.

Controls and access
On 20 August, Africanews reported that the AFC/M23 rebel alliance was tightening movement controls after two travellers from a government-held area tested positive for Ebola in rebel-held territory. The report presents the measures in the language of containment, a plausible public-health rationale. But the action also changes the operating conditions for medical teams and populations already caught in an armed conflict.
The report does not specify which routes were closed, how long the restrictions would last or whether humanitarian vehicles were exempt. It does establish that movement control is being asserted inside the same eastern territory where responders are trying to reach people exposed to Ebola. Access is already fragile in a different way. Africanews reported on 19 August that hostility from local communities was leading to regular attacks on WHO ambulances. The source attributes the attacks to hostility but does not identify a single cause, a particular locality or the people responsible. It also does not support the stronger formulation that community hostility is the central operational constraint.
The practical consequence is still clear from the report: attacks on ambulances affect the Ebola response. An ambulance is not only transport. It is part of the chain that moves patients, staff and supplies. If vehicles cannot operate safely, contact tracing, referrals and rapid investigation become harder, even when vaccine doses are available.
Fear inside the health system
The outbreak is also changing how people use healthcare. Africanews reported on 19 August that fear of Ebola was keeping pregnant women away from health facilities in eastern DRC. The report warned that the shift could increase the risk of stillbirths, premature births and maternal deaths.
This is a second-order public-health crisis, but it is not an abstract warning. A woman who avoids a clinic because she fears infection may lose access to antenatal care, delivery assistance or treatment for complications. The source does not provide the number of women affected, the facilities involved or the size of the resulting increase in adverse outcomes. It supports the risk assessment, not a quantified claim about deaths already caused by avoidance.
Monexus analysis: the evidence points to a feedback loop. Fear reduces healthcare use; reduced healthcare use can leave illness and pregnancy complications less visible; an expanding outbreak then reinforces fear. Breaking that loop requires more than a vaccine shipment. It requires trusted communication, safe transport and services that can continue for people who do not have Ebola.
